导言
在当前快速发展的技术环境下,高性能单片机在各种应用场景中扮演着越来越重要的角色。然而,面对市场上众多的单片机选择,如何选型一款适合自己应用的高性能单片机成了一个很重要的问题。本文将从实战角度,提供一些选型指南和经验分享,帮助读者更好地选择高性能单片机。
性能参数
在选型单片机时,首先要了解的是该单片机的性能参数。以下是一些常见的性能参数值及其意义:
- 处理器速度(Clock Speed):指单片机的工作频率,单位为赫兹(Hz)。较高的处理器速度意味着更快的计算能力,适用于需要高速处理的场景。
- 存储器容量(Memory):指单片机上的存储空间,包括程序存储(Flash)、数据存储(RAM)等。较大的存储容量可以支持更复杂的算法和更大规模的数据处理。
- 外设接口(Peripherals):指单片机所支持的外设接口,如串口、SPI、I2C等。根据具体应用需求,选择合适的外设接口非常重要。
- 低功耗特性(Low Power Features):指单片机在低功耗运行模式下的能力,如待机功耗、休眠功耗等。低功耗特性对于电池供电或长时间运行的应用非常重要。
- 工作温度范围(Operating Temperature):指单片机可以正常工作的温度范围。根据具体应用场景,选择适合的工作温度范围是必要的。
选型指南
在了解了性能参数后,以下是一些选型指南,帮助读者在选型高性能单片机时做出合适的决策:
- 定义应用需求:首先明确自己的应用需求,包括计算能力、存储需求、外设接口要求等。根据应用需求,筛选出符合要求的单片机性能参数。
- 参考推荐列表:查找厂商或技术社区提供的推荐列表,这些列表一般会根据不同应用场景和需求进行分类,有助于快速定位适合自己的单片机。
- 考虑可扩展性:如果应用可能会有后续的功能扩展或升级需求,建议选择具有较高扩展性的单片机,以便灵活满足未来需求。
- 查看开发工具和文档支持:查找厂商提供的开发工具和文档支持情况。良好的开发工具和丰富的文档可以提高开发效率和解决问题的能力。
- 考虑成本因素:不仅要考虑单片机本身的成本,还要考虑开发工具、外围电路等的成本。综合考虑各方面因素,找到性价比最高的单片机。
实战经验分享
最后,分享一些实战经验,帮助读者更好地选型高性能单片机:
- 充分了解应用场景:在选型前,充分了解自己的应用场景,包括需要的处理速度、存储容量、外设接口等。根据实际需求制定选型标准。
- 参考相关案例:寻找类似应用场景的相关案例,了解别人的选型经验和使用心得。这可以帮助你快速找到适合自己的单片机。
- 多方面比较:在确定几款备选单片机后,综合考虑各个方面的因素,如性能、功耗、价格等进行比较。制定一张详细的对比表格有助于做出决策。
- 考虑未来发展:在选型时,不仅要考虑当前的应用需求,还要考虑未来可能的功能扩展和升级需求。选择具有较高扩展性的单片机是一个明智的选择。
结语
选型一款高性能单片机是一个需要慎重考虑的决策,本文提供了一些选型指南和实战经验,希望可以帮助读者更好地选择合适的单片机。记住,在选型过程中,不仅要关注性能参数,还要考虑应用需求、可扩展性、成本等因素,从而找到最适合自己应用的高性能单片机。一步步合理的选型过程将为项目的成功奠定坚实的基础。
本文来自极简博客,作者:心灵的迷宫,转载请注明原文链接:高性能单片机的选型指南